Immerse yourself in the intricate and captivating world of Michael Tippett's String Quartets with the release of "Tippett, M.: String Quartets, Vol. 2 - Nos. 3, 5" on Naxos. This neoclassical masterpiece, released on October 27, 2009, offers a rich and diverse listening experience that spans nearly an hour.
The album features two complete string quartets, the Third and Fifth, each divided into distinct movements that showcase Tippett's unique compositional style and profound musicality. The Third Quartet opens with a grave and sustained introduction that gradually builds into a moderate allegro, setting the stage for the introspective andante and the lively allegro molto e con brio that follows. The quartet concludes with a slow, reflective movement that leads into a final allegro comodo.
The Fifth Quartet, on the other hand, begins with a medium-fast tempo that immediately draws the listener in, followed by a slow, contemplative movement that provides a stark contrast.
